编程课程通常涵盖多个领域,旨在教授学生如何编写、调试和优化计算机程序。以下是一些常见的编程课程:
1. 基础编程语言:
C语言
C++语言
Java语言
Python语言
JavaScript语言
PHP语言
Ruby语言
2. 高级编程语言:
C语言
Swift语言
Kotlin语言
3. 数据结构与算法:
数据结构(如数组、链表、栈、队列、树、图等)
算法分析(如排序、搜索、动态规划等)
4. 数据库技术:
关系型数据库(如MySQL、Oracle、SQL Server)
非关系型数据库(如MongoDB、Redis等)
5. 软件工程:
软件开发过程
软件测试与质量控制
版本控制(如Git)
6. 计算机组成原理:
计算机体系结构
操作系统原理
计算机网络
7. Web开发:
HTML、CSS、JavaScript
前端框架(如React、Vue、Angular等)
后端开发(如Node.js、Ruby on Rails、Django等)
8. 移动应用开发:
Android开发
iOS开发(Swift、Objective-C)
9. 人工智能与机器学习:
机器学习算法(如决策树、支持向量机、神经网络等)
人工智能应用(如自然语言处理、图像识别等)
10. 云计算与大数据:
云计算基础(如AWS、Azure、Google Cloud等)
大数据处理(如Hadoop、Spark等)
11. 游戏开发:
游戏引擎(如Unity、Unreal Engine等)
游戏设计原理
这些课程可以根据学生的兴趣、专业背景和目标进行选择和组合。不同的学校和培训机构可能会提供不同的课程设置。
发表回复
评论列表(0条)